A workshop lesson for the age of AI agents

Anyone who builds, repairs or restores things knows the danger of acting before checking the plans. A confident cut made from the wrong measurement is still a bad cut. Firmulate has now demonstrated the business equivalent: an AI can identify a problem, propose the right response and sound completely competent—yet still lose a €55,000 deal because it failed to read the company’s own files.

The decisive information was not included in the customer event. It sat two document references deep in the software company’s records: a competitor weakness that justified holding firm on price. The models that found it signed the deal at full price, adding €4,583 in monthly recurring revenue. Those that missed it lost automatically.

That makes “reads your files before answering” more than a desirable feature. In this experiment, it became a measurable capability with a direct purchasing consequence.

The difference between diagnosis and completion

Firmulate runs frontier AI models as complete companies rather than testing them with isolated chat questions. Each model faced the same small software business during its worst week, with identical customers, crises and temptations. Every decision was versioned and auditable.

The models were not confused by the visible problems. All spotted every crisis, and all refused every manipulation attempt. Yet only two signed the €55,000 deal that their own work had earned. Firmulate summarized the gap sharply: “Same diagnosis, same pitch — no signature.”

That distinction matters to practical-minded buyers. In a workshop, noticing a loose joint is not the same as repairing it. In business, drafting a persuasive sales response is not the same as closing. An agent may produce polished analysis while failing at the final action that creates value.

The clue was in the company’s own material

The most revealing part of the test was where the useful fact appeared. It was not conveniently surfaced in the customer’s request. Reaching it required following two references through the company’s documents before responding.

The models that did this homework discovered the competitor weakness and had enough evidence to defend the full price. The others could still recognize the opportunity and construct the pitch, but they lacked the buried fact needed to finish confidently. The failure was therefore not primarily one of eloquence. It was a failure to gather the available evidence before acting.

For businesses evaluating agents, this changes the buying question. A demonstration that asks an AI to summarize a supplied document tests only what happens after someone has already selected the relevant material. Real work is messier. The critical instruction, exception or commercial detail may be buried in operating notes, referenced from another file or separated from the event that demands a decision.

A league table shaped by follow-through

The final Crucible League results from July 2026 put gpt-5.6-sol first with 95, followed by Kimi K3 with 93, Sonnet 5 with 88, Fable 5 with 77 and Opus 4.8 with 73. A do-nothing baseline scored 26 because partial progress counted. A single breach of trust capped the total under the principle that “no amount of good work outweighs a breach of trust.” The complete results are available on Firmulate’s public benchmarks page.

The standings also reveal why thoroughness alone is an incomplete measure. Opus 4.8 produced the deepest analyses and learned 80 additional rules, yet finished last. It left the close on the table and attempted to write into a locked department instead of escalating. The same discipline weakness appeared in all four other models, though less strongly.

There is also an important comparison caveat: Kimi K3 ran with the API default because it had no effort parameter, while the other models ran at xhigh. That fairness note does not erase the result, but it belongs beside any interpretation of the rankings.

Security held; execution separated the field

The agents also faced fake CEO messages that escalated over three stages, followed by a reporter seeking “just one yes/no, on background.” All 5 models refused. Kimi K3 recorded the reasoning: “Treat the request as a suspected approval-bypass / possible impersonation.”

This is a useful contrast. The entire field resisted the obvious attempts to manipulate it, but the models diverged on ordinary operational diligence. The test suggests that safe refusal and productive completion are separate capabilities. A business needs both.

The company being run is synthetic but the mechanics are concrete: 13 employees, monthly burn of €105k against €2.3k in monthly recurring revenue, a public cash countdown and more than 680 self-learned playbook rules. Every workday is versioned, and the experiment is live and watchable through Firmulate.

Test the agent on the work between the prompt and the answer

For tool users, the practical lesson is familiar: inspect the material, trace the references and confirm the constraint before committing. AI agents should be judged by the same standard.

A useful evaluation should therefore ask more than whether a model writes a good reply. Can it locate the relevant files without being handed them? Will it follow references far enough to uncover a decisive fact? Does it complete the action its analysis supports? And does it preserve discipline when access is blocked?

Firmulate’s experiment turns those questions into observable behavior. Its 242 real, unedited management decisions also power a public “guess the model” quiz, illustrating how difficult it can be to identify systems from prose alone. The commercial differences emerge through actions.

Enterprises can run the same wargame against a read-only export of their own business, with nothing written back to real systems. That is a sensible proving ground: before giving an AI access to the operational workshop, see whether it reads the plans—and whether it finishes the job.
